Output 19bb858341a2086944a0f640fcb88d8840340d5013805d356d669960a197ef95:7

value
3959362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943d0f8035c6e48a2e4475bdcd59e6e2c3a6bd6d OP_EQUAL
address
3FCq5ViyUK4M5MfrvX56p4CsgywcZVAHJE
transaction
19bb858341a2086944a0f640fcb88d8840340d5013805d356d669960a197ef95
spent
true